Azza
Azza (legal entity USEAZZA LTD) is a Lagos-based fintech that embeds a crypto wallet and fiat on/off-ramp inside WhatsApp. Users buy, sell, swap and send stablecoins and other assets by chatting with an AI agent—no separate banking app required.1 It was founded in 2024 by Toochukwu Okoro and Joshua (Akachi) Avoaja and opened more broadly in 2025.
History
The founders argued that the next wave of African fintech users would not install new apps. WhatsApp is already the default communication layer, so Azza put KYC, balances and cash-out into chat. Coverage in 2026 highlighted USDT-to-USD conversions into Nigerian domiciliary accounts and a push to replace risky P2P OTC with an in-chat flow.2
Founders
Toochukwu Okoro is co-founder and chief executive officer, active in Nigerian fintech and crypto policy circles.
Joshua Avoaja is co-founder and chief technology officer.
Model
Azza is a messaging-native wallet, not a licensed deposit bank. It routes stablecoins (including Circle’s USDC and naira-linked cNGN) across multiple chains and pays out to local bank accounts and mobile money. Circle lists Azza in its alliance directory as a WhatsApp wallet for Africa.
Products
In-WhatsApp buy/sell of crypto and stablecoins, phone-number sends (no wallet address required), multi-chain swaps and bridges, and instant cash-out to local currency. The product is often cited as proof that “living inside WhatsApp” can be a distribution strategy, not a gimmick.
